Job Description

About Us Pennsylvania Veterinary Care is a compassionate veterinary practice dedicated to providing exceptional care for our patients and outstanding service to their owners. We are seeking a reliable, hardworking Veterinary Cleaner/Kennel Assistant to help maintain a clean, safe, and comfortable environment for our animals, clients, and staff. Responsibilities Clean and disinfect kennels, cages, exam rooms, treatment areas, and common spaces Launder and replace animal bedding, towels, and blankets Feed and provide fresh water to boarding and hospitalized animals as directed Walk dogs and assist with basic animal care needs Monitor animals for signs of illness, stress, or discomfort and report concerns to veterinary staff Dispose of waste and maintain sanitation standards throughout the facility Stock cleaning supplies and notify management when inventory is low Assist veterinary staff with animal handling and other duties as needed Maintain a professional and positive attitude with clients and coworkers Qualifications Previous kennel, animal care, cleaning, or veterinary experience preferred but not required Comfortable working around dogs, cats, and other animals of varying sizes and temperaments Ability to stand, walk, bend, lift up to 50 pounds, and perform physical tasks throughout the shift Dependable, punctual, and detail-oriented Strong work ethic and willingness to learn
